Output 90bba5ad5aa6fa56b952b453caa530d6d260d145c805d375fcd8f8cb8a7cdfbd:1

value
19800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66ea0803cad43b92610359030ae2736540b54d16 OP_EQUALVERIFY OP_CHECKSIG
address
LUc7YZSHXCJeD4GSYHpdfafQ1Mz3pfzp9S
transaction
90bba5ad5aa6fa56b952b453caa530d6d260d145c805d375fcd8f8cb8a7cdfbd
spent
true